Phân tích vai trò của hàm CAST trong việc chuyển đổi kiểu dữ liệu SQL cho ứng dụng xử lý dữ liệu lớn
Trong thế giới số hóa ngày nay, việc xử lý dữ liệu lớn trở nên ngày càng quan trọng. Để xử lý dữ liệu lớn một cách hiệu quả, chúng ta cần sử dụng các công cụ và kỹ thuật phù hợp. Một trong những công cụ quan trọng đó là hàm CAST trong SQL, giúp chúng ta chuyển đổi kiểu dữ liệu của dữ liệu.
<h2 style="font-weight: bold; margin: 12px 0;">Hàm CAST trong SQL có vai trò gì?</h2>Hàm CAST trong SQL có vai trò quan trọng trong việc chuyển đổi kiểu dữ liệu. Nó cho phép lập trình viên chuyển đổi một giá trị từ một kiểu dữ liệu này sang kiểu dữ liệu khác. Ví dụ, bạn có thể chuyển đổi một chuỗi thành số nguyên, hoặc một số nguyên thành số thực. Điều này rất hữu ích khi bạn cần xử lý dữ liệu đầu vào có kiểu dữ liệu không phù hợp với yêu cầu của ứng dụng.
<h2 style="font-weight: bold; margin: 12px 0;">Tại sao hàm CAST lại quan trọng trong xử lý dữ liệu lớn?</h2>Hàm CAST đóng vai trò quan trọng trong xử lý dữ liệu lớn vì nó cho phép chúng ta xử lý dữ liệu có kiểu dữ liệu khác nhau một cách linh hoạt. Trong xử lý dữ liệu lớn, chúng ta thường phải làm việc với nhiều nguồn dữ liệu khác nhau, mỗi nguồn có thể có kiểu dữ liệu khác nhau. Hàm CAST giúp chúng ta chuyển đổi dữ liệu từ kiểu này sang kiểu khác một cách dễ dàng, giúp tăng cường khả năng tương thích và linh hoạt của ứng dụng.
<h2 style="font-weight: bold; margin: 12px 0;">Làm thế nào để sử dụng hàm CAST trong SQL?</h2>Để sử dụng hàm CAST trong SQL, bạn cần chỉ định kiểu dữ liệu mà bạn muốn chuyển đổi đến, cũng như giá trị cần chuyển đổi. Cú pháp cơ bản của hàm CAST như sau: CAST (giá trị AS kiểu dữ liệu). Ví dụ, để chuyển đổi một chuỗi thành số nguyên, bạn có thể sử dụng cú pháp sau: CAST ('123' AS INT).
<h2 style="font-weight: bold; margin: 12px 0;">Có những hạn chế nào khi sử dụng hàm CAST trong SQL?</h2>Mặc dù hàm CAST rất mạnh mẽ và linh hoạt, nhưng nó cũng có một số hạn chế. Một trong những hạn chế lớn nhất là không thể chuyển đổi một số kiểu dữ liệu sang một số kiểu dữ liệu khác. Ví dụ, bạn không thể chuyển đổi một giá trị ngày tháng thành một số nguyên. Ngoài ra, việc chuyển đổi một giá trị từ một kiểu dữ liệu này sang kiểu dữ liệu khác có thể dẫn đến mất mát dữ liệu nếu kiểu dữ liệu mục tiêu không thể chứa tất cả thông tin từ kiểu dữ liệu nguồn.
<h2 style="font-weight: bold; margin: 12px 0;">Có thể sử dụng hàm CAST trong SQL để chuyển đổi kiểu dữ liệu của cột không?</h2>Có, bạn có thể sử dụng hàm CAST trong SQL để chuyển đổi kiểu dữ liệu của một cột. Điều này rất hữu ích khi bạn cần thay đổi kiểu dữ liệu của một cột để phù hợp với yêu cầu của ứng dụng. Tuy nhiên, bạn cần cẩn thận khi thực hiện điều này, vì việc chuyển đổi kiểu dữ liệu của một cột có thể dẫn đến mất mát dữ liệu nếu kiểu dữ liệu mới không thể chứa tất cả thông tin từ kiểu dữ liệu cũ.
Như vậy, hàm CAST trong SQL đóng một vai trò quan trọng trong việc xử lý dữ liệu lớn. Nó không chỉ giúp chúng ta chuyển đổi kiểu dữ liệu của dữ liệu, mà còn tăng cường khả năng tương thích và linh hoạt của ứng dụng. Tuy nhiên, khi sử dụng hàm CAST, chúng ta cần lưu ý một số hạn chế và cẩn thận để tránh mất mát dữ liệu.